Outside the UK Bubble: What International Casinos Actually Offer https://oasisflproperties.com/outside-the-uk-bubble-what-international-casinos/ https://oasisflproperties.com/outside-the-uk-bubble-what-international-casinos/#respond Sun, 23 Aug 2026 17:36:47 +0000 https://oasisflproperties.com/?p=110142 The conversation around online gambling in the UK keeps circling back to the same question: what happens when you step outside GamStop? A growing number of players are finding the answer is simply more room to move – bigger bonuses, higher limits, faster payouts, and fewer hoops between you and the game. If you are weighing that move, a platform like fortune clock casino gives a fair idea of the shape of things out there: international licensing, cryptocurrency payments, and a registration process that does not demand your entire life story. It is not about dodging responsibility. It is about choosing a different regulatory trade-off.

What GamStop Actually Is

GamStop is a UK self-exclusion scheme. When you sign up, participating operators are legally required to block your access for the period you select. International casinos sit outside that system entirely because they are licensed in other jurisdictions. For some players, that independence is the whole point. For others, it is simply a fact to understand before registering anywhere.

Where International Casinos Pull Ahead

International operators win on flexibility, not on polish. They tend to beat UK-regulated sites on the things that matter most when you play regularly:

  • Higher deposit and betting ceilings than most UK-regulated platforms allow
  • Crypto and alternative payment methods that move faster than standard bank routes
  • Lighter identity verification – basic details get you playing quickly
  • More generous bonus structures with less punishing wagering conditions

How to Register the Smart Way

The process at most international casinos is short, but the order matters. Follow a sequence that protects you from the start:

  1. Pick a licensed operator with a recognised international licence and a solid reputation
  2. Create an account with basic information – this should take minutes, not days
  3. Choose your payment method, from cards to crypto, based on your preferred limits
  4. Deposit and read the bonus terms before you play a single spin

UK-Regulated vs International: A Quick Comparison

Feature UK-Regulated Casino International Casino
Betting limits Lower, strictly capped Higher, more flexible
Verification Lengthy, document-heavy Fast, often minimal
Payments Cards and some e-wallets Adds crypto, prepaid cards, alt services
Self-exclusion Tied to GamStop Independent of the scheme

The Trade-Offs Nobody Mentions

None of this is free. International casinos sit outside UK oversight, which means responsible gambling tools vary widely between operators. The protection you get depends entirely on the licensing authority behind the site. A valid licence means the operator answers to a real regulator on fair gaming, security, and player funds – but you have to check which authority it is before you trust it.

The Takeaway

If you go international, do it with your eyes open. Verify the licence first, test the withdrawal speed with a small amount before you deposit anything serious, and read the bonus terms as if they were written by someone trying to trap you – because some of them are. Play at a licensed, proven operator, and treat the freedom from GamStop as a choice you make deliberately, not a loophole you fall through.

The Welcome Bonus: Big Numbers, Fine Print

The headline offer is up to £3,000 plus 225 free spins. Here is how the wagering works:

  1. Minimum deposit of £10 qualifies you for the bonus.
  2. The bonus amount must be wagered 30 times before withdrawal.
  3. You have 30 days to complete wagering, and the maximum bet during that period is £5 per spin.
  4. PayPal is explicitly excluded from bonus use.

A small deposit gets you a small bonus. A maximum deposit gets you the full £3,000 – but you will need to wager £90,000 before you see a penny. That is the arithmetic. The marketing says “up to £3,000.” The maths says “good luck.”
